United States Increases Visa Validity For Nigerians To 5 Years

The United States has announced that starting March 1, 2023, it will increase visitor visa validity from 24 months to 60 months for Nigerians who want to enter the United States temporarily for business and/or tourism.

The visa validity extension allows Nigerians to use the visa for 60 months to make short trips to the United States for tourism or business purposes before having to renew their visa.

The visa application fee, currently USD160, will not increase as a result of the increased visa validity.
